On Sun, Feb 10, 2008 at 09:06:08PM +0100, Jiri Olsa wrote: > Hi, > > I have problem with last Linus' git tree: > > scripts/kconfig/conf -s arch/um/Kconfig > SYMLINK arch/um/include/kern_constants.h > SYMLINK arch/um/include/sysdep > CHK arch/um/include/uml-config.h > UPD arch/um/include/uml-config.h > CC arch/um/sys-i386/user-offsets.s > In file included from /usr/include/asm/ptrace.h:5, > from arch/um/sys-i386/user-offsets.c:7: > /usr/include/asm/ptrace-abi.h:92: error: expected specifier-qualifier-list > before 'u32'
This looks like a bug in your headers. ptrace-abi includes <asm/types.h>, apparently to get the likes of u32, but they're not there. > arch/um/sys-i386/user-offsets.c: In function 'foo': > arch/um/sys-i386/user-offsets.c:20: error: 'struct sigcontext' has > no member named 'eip' This is a bit of a problem. You installed new headers, which have the 'e' removed from the register names, but I can't just change UML because that will break compilation on current hosts with existing headers. Jeff -- Work email - jdike at linux dot intel dot com ------------------------------------------------------------------------- This SF.net email is sponsored by: Microsoft Defy all challenges. Microsoft(R) Visual Studio 2008. http://clk.atdmt.com/MRT/go/vse0120000070mrt/direct/01/ _______________________________________________ User-mode-linux-devel mailing list User-mode-linux-devel@lists.sourceforge.net https://lists.sourceforge.net/lists/listinfo/user-mode-linux-devel